On Mon, 2 Feb 2004 14:46:24 +0100 (CET) Jozsef Kadlecsik <kadlec@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x> wrote: > > You convinced me: something is really fishy. I fire up debugging and > checking. I also have some problems with conntrack since updating to 2.6.2rc3 from 2.6.1 on x86-64. Some TCP connections for the masqueraded machines seem to go extremly slow. I haven't investigated more closely yet. /proc/slabinfo doesn't show leaks for the conntrack slab though. -Andi |
